Do I need a Nano SIM to turn on my iPhone or can I just activate it to turn it on?

I got a new iPhone and it said it needed a SIM card, I took out a SIM card out of my tablet and it didn't work (Because it was a Micro card) and I was wondering if I can just activate it through phone call(I have straight talk) or do I really need a Nano SIM card?

Your phone needs a sim card to function as a cell phone. You can buy the right sim card at walmart.

SIM card is must for activation and you've StraightTalk which is GSM. It's not a problem though, you can just go to any phone store or Walmart and have your SIM trimmed to nano-SIM. Then you can activate the phone.
